The City of Cultural Crossroads

Cirebon is a historic port city on the north coast of West Java, once the capital of the Cirebon Sultanate and a center of Islamic learning, trade, and culture. It is a place where Javanese, Sundanese, Chinese, and Islamic traditions converge, reflected in its unique architecture, cuisine, and the legacy of Sunan Gunung Jati, one of the Wali Songo.

History

Cirebon was founded by Sunan Gunung Jati, one of the Wali Songo, in the 15th century. It became the capital of the Cirebon Sultanate and a center of Islamic learning, trade, and culture. The city was a meeting point for Javanese, Sundanese, Chinese, and Islamic traditions.

Culture

Cirebon is known for its unique cultural heritage:

  • Keraton (Palaces) : The Kasepuhan and Kanoman palaces, blending Javanese, Islamic, and Chinese architectural styles.
  • Batik: Cirebon’s batik features distinctive patterns influenced by Chinese and Islamic motifs.
  • Cuisine: Cirebon’s cuisine reflects its cultural diversity, with dishes like empal gentong and nasi jamblang.
